Turaida Museum Reserve invites all interested participants, especially representatives of the tourism sector, to attend the Information Day. During the event, upcoming exhibitions at Turaida Castle and a new exhibition in the church will be presented, along with the latest collection catalogue ā€œ13th–17th Century Military Antiquities Found at Turaida Castle.ā€ The key highlights and plans for 2026 will also be outlined.

As part of the Information Day, participants will also be introduced to the open-air interactive exhibition ā€œNature’s Pearlsā€ created within the project ā€œGarden Pearls for Allā€ in the territory of Turaida Museum Reserve – Turaida Forest Park. The exhibition has been open to visitors since 6 September 2025. It was created to provide a family-friendly, accessible, and educational environment that fosters understanding of biodiversity and its importance.

In 2026, several significant new developments are planned at Turaida Museum Reserve. Two new exhibitions will open at Turaida Castle. In the Main Tower, visitors will be able to explore an exhibition dedicated to the eight centuries of the castle’s history. In the North Inner Gate Tower – a historically uncovered and conserved building – visitors will learn about the tower’s role in the castle’s defence system.

After a break of several years, the Midsummer celebration will return to Turaida on 21 June under the motto ā€œOver the Hill.ā€ The event will begin at sunrise and continue until midnight, concluding with a concert by the folklore group Iļģi and communal dancing.

During the Information Day, a guest lecture will be delivered by social anthropologist and Associate Professor at the University of Latvia, Aivita Putniņa, titled ā€œHow Is the Family Changing — and Is the Museum Changing with It?ā€ The lecture-workshop will encourage discussion about changes in family relationships and their impact on the role of museums in contemporary society.
